The number 6.527314 to two decimal places is 6.53. To round a number to two decimal places, you look at the third decimal place. If it is 5 or greater, you round up the second decimal place. If it is less than 5, you leave the second decimal place as is. In this case, the third decimal place is 7, so we round up the second decimal place from 2 to 3.
To round 5.83 to one decimal place, you look at the digit in the second decimal place, which is 3. Since 3 is less than 5, you do not round up the first decimal place. Therefore, 5.83 rounded to one decimal place is 5.8.

To round 11.972 to one decimal place, you look at the digit in the second decimal place, which is 7. Since 7 is greater than or equal to 5, you round the first decimal place up from 9 to 10. Therefore, 11.972 rounded to one decimal place is 12.0.
